Best Products for Hood Cleaning
Selecting the right cleaning products is essential for effective and safe hood maintenance. Not all degreasers or cleaning agents are suitable for stainless steel, aluminum, or coated surfaces. The best products remove grease quickly without corroding materials or leaving chemical residues.
Look for cleaners labeled food-safe, non-flammable, and biodegradable. Many kitchen supply stores carry specialized hood degreasers designed to dissolve hardened oils without harsh scrubbing.

Always test on a small area first to ensure compatibility. According to Cleaning agent guidelines, using the correct pH level prevents damage to metal finishes.
Additionally, tools like microfiber cloths, nylon brushes, and low-pressure sprayers help clean efficiently without scratching surfaces. Pairing the right product with proper technique ensures deep cleaning, longer equipment life, and compliance with hygiene standards. Avoid bleach or ammonia mixtures, which can corrode metal and release harmful fumes.
